    Dean A.

    One of my dining rules is to not try a restaurant until it's been open for at least 90 days as it usually takes that long to get their grounding and work out all the kinks. Having said that we decided to try this place even though they'd only been in business for a couple of weeks because our kids were in town and we were looking for a different place to take them. Overall it was a mixed bag (mostly good) but I'm grading on a curve due to the recent opening. Saturday night, reservations for four at 7pm. The dining room was packed and boisterous but not too loud. We were originally promptly seated at a booth near the window overlooking the pool area however the sun was setting in that direction and right in our faces so we asked for a different table and the hostess was happy to accommodate. Our server Christian was very friendly and welcoming (although it took him several minutes to get to our table - again new restaurant) and we decided to order multiple items to share so we could sample a lot on the menu. That ended up being a good idea because this place is kind of like a tapas restaurant in that the dishes are rather small and tend towards snack and appetizer sized portions. We ordered the Pocket Bread, cornbread, deviled eggs, boudin balls, meatballs, fried chicken, crab linguine, gumbo and fried chicken salad. The bread is very creative - it's like a large crispy pita and was quite fresh. We found the cornbread to be well made but way too sweet for our tastes - it's more like a dessert. The eggs were good, nothing terribly special. We really enjoyed the boudin balls (kind of like an arancini with sausage inside) and the meatballs were well made and tasty. I liked the crab linguine but this is more of a crab-flavored pasta dish as opposed to a crab dish so be forwarned. The last "small plate" item was the gumbo which was my personal favorite of the meal - not surprising based on Emeril's background. It has a nice depth of flavor with large chunks of delicious andouille and tender shrimp. The two fried chicken dishes were listed as entrees but again were rather small portions for that designation. They both used the same basic cut which is a part breast and part thigh pounded thin and then breaded. Again be forewarned that it's not all white meat. I prefer dark meat chicken so I enjoyed it but everyone else at my table not so much. I thought it had good flavor although both dishes were delivered somewhat lukewarm. My wife loves Emeril's banana cream pie and orders it at every one of his restaurants so of course we tried the version here. It was pretty basic - good flavor but the crust was a little hard and difficult to cut. We also tried the beignets which were not good. They're just not prepared properly so instead of being the heavenly pillows of goodness like in New Orleans they were dense and way too chewy. I definitely would avoid them. Dinner for four came to $206 before tax and tip which wasn't bad considering that included a large glass of Pinot Grigio and two soft drinks. We did have some leftovers to bring home. Service was good all things considered and the staff appears to really be trying. I would give them a couple more months to get it together and then give it another shot.

    Kari U.

    I'm a fan of Emeril's restaurants so I was excited to see him opening one at the M. We went on a Friday night, maybe a week or so after they opened. It was busy but we had a reservation and were seated quickly. Main takeaways - service was good (slightly slow but understandable for a new restaurant on a busy night) - food was okay (some items were great, others were meh) - pricing is on the higher side value and quality wise. We ordered the: - pineapple upside down cornbread (great mix of sweet and savory, small portion) - house boudin balls (also good, best way to describe it is a mix between a pork meatball and an arancini) - blue crab linguine (light sauce which I liked, not very spicy even with Calabrian chili, could've used more crab but a good portion of pasta) - ribeye (the cut/quality was mediocre especially for the $56 price tag, small portion 8-10 oz, 1/2 inch thick, disappointing) I don't mind paying for quality but you can get a much better steak for a few dollars more at Anthony's. The ambiance was casual. If you're seated near the windows, it gets very warm, especially when it's over 100 degrees outside. Overall, I would give them another try as some of the menu items were good. But they need to strike a better balance between quality and pricing.
